  • poppy123456
    poppy123456 Online Community Member Posts: 64,463 Championing

    Citizens Advice is not somewhere I would recommend for advice either because I've known them give misleading advice many times.

    Once you submit a claim for UC your housing benefit and Income Related ESA will continue for 2 weeks and then both of them will stop.
